GROWTH OF THE NORTH AMERICAN STURGEON ( POLYODON SPATHULA ) DURING THE POST-EMBRYONIC DEVELOPMENT PERIOD IN PROTECTED AREAS

(STEF92 Technology, 2023-10-01, Mioara Costache, Daniela Radu, Nino Marica, M. Costache, Mariana Cristina Arcade)

Show more

The article includes the results obtained in the growth experiments during the postembryonic development period of the North American sturgeon species Polyodon spathula. The experiments took place in the years 2020 and 2021. Sturgeon larvae aged 5 days old, obtained through artificial reproduction at SCDP Nucet, were stocked and raised until the age of 35 days in two variants, in concrete tanks (useful volume -120 m3 /tank), located in the pilot station intended for fish culture experiments from the SCDP Nucet gen...

RESEARCHES CONCERNING FOOD AND FEEDING BEHAVIOR OF PADDLEFISH (POLYODON SPATHULA, WALB. 1792) IN LANDSCAPED AQUATIC ECOSYSTEMS

(STEF92 Technology, 2017-06-20, Mioara Costache, Mihail Costache, Cecilia Bucur, Daniela Radu, Nino Marica)

Show more

This paper presents results of research on feeding behavior of paddlefish (Polyodon spathula, Walb. 1792), performed at the Fish Culture Research and Development Station Nucet, DпїЅmbovi?a, between 2002 -2007. The results confirmed the planctonofag character of this species. Paddlefish food consists primarily of zooplankton, insects and insect larvae, plant debris and detritus, identified in the intestinal contents.
